EDITORS COMMENTS
This fascinating historical print from 1886 showcases a collection of advertisements for illustrated books aimed at children. These books were not just meant for entertainment, but also served as tools for indoctrination and education in Victorian society. Some of the books were designed to be colored in by the children themselves, while others were specifically created to instill Christian values and principles in young minds.
In this snapshot of the past, we see how advertising was used as a means of shaping behavior and upbringing in children. The emphasis on good behavior and religious teachings is evident in the messaging of these ads, reflecting the societal norms and values of the time.
The image provides a window into a bygone era when literature played a crucial role in molding young individuals into "good little Christians." It serves as a reminder of how different educational approaches were back then compared to modern times.
Overall, this print is not just a glimpse into the world of advertising history, but also an insight into how childhood education and religion intersected during the late 19th century.
